Output 65576a7427307d507eefffe834b393dcab0439f91e3b4306ddde6724ae6adf93:0

value
32000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86600e990ef3e26eb2f3e809c806cf847cb4da9e OP_EQUAL
address
3DwXYQcjywCHpnMdGTWULR3GAL41nrYtwP
transaction
65576a7427307d507eefffe834b393dcab0439f91e3b4306ddde6724ae6adf93
spent
true